''It''s a little book of wonder, it''s fantastic'' Chris Evans''A fabulously sparky, wide-ranging and horizon-broadening little study ... joyously unboring'' Sunday TimesFriends do it, strangers do it and so do chimpanzees - and it''s not just deeply embedded in our history and culture, it may even be written in our DNA. The humble handshake, it turns out, has a rich and surprising history.So let''s join palaeoanthropologist Ella Al-Shamahi as she embarks on a funny and fascinating voyage of discovery - from the handshake''s origins (at least seven million years ago) all the way to its sudden disappearance in March 2020. Drawing on new research, anthropological insights and first-hand experience, she''ll reveal how this most friendly of gestures has played a role in everything from meetings with uncontacted tribes to political assassinations - and what it tells us about the enduring power of human contact.Because the story of the handshake ... is far from over.
